A member asked:

Glaucoma oct scan 8 mos. apart show change in thickness w/treatment. quadrants went from 90 to 84 & 68 to 63 (yellow to red) dr. said no change. why?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Glaucoma OCT: As with other adjunctive tests for glaucoma management, will provide information to an ophthalmologist to help them treat you properly. In general, we try to treat the patient's clinical exam status and if that is stable, we often won't treat based just on a change in the test. Discuss your concerns with your ophthalmologist.
